在vscode中使用Git的教程
vscode簡介
VSCode是微軟推出的一款輕量編輯器,采取了和VS相同的UI界面,搭配合適的插件可以優(yōu)化前端開發(fā)的體驗(yàn)。
布局:左側(cè)是用于展示所要編輯的所有文件和文件夾的文件管理器,依次是資源管理器,搜索,GIT,調(diào)試,插件,右側(cè)是打開文件的編輯區(qū)域,最多可同時(shí)打開三個(gè)編輯區(qū)域到側(cè)邊。在初次使用時(shí)如果本地沒有安裝git會提示先安裝git,然后重啟vscode。
用了git最方便的就是比如在公司寫了很多代碼后回到家打開vscode只需要點(diǎn)擊一下pull就能全部同步過來。是不是很方便。。。。畢竟之前我都是拿u盤拷貝回家或者存到云盤再下載下來。。
我這里用的是國內(nèi)的碼云托管的代碼,,github都是英文看不懂。。
因?yàn)関scode中帶的有g(shù)it管理功能,只需要學(xué)一點(diǎn)關(guān)于git的操作知識就夠了。
首頁要下載‘msysgit'然后安裝到電腦要不然vscode中的git是不能用的。安裝完成后主要使用Git Bash這個(gè)程序來操作
1、將代碼放到碼云
- 到碼云里新建一個(gè)倉庫,完成后碼云會有一個(gè)命令教程按上面的來就行了
- 碼云中的使用教程
Git 全局設(shè)置:
git config --global user.name "ASxx" git config --global user.email 123456789@qq.com
創(chuàng)建 git 倉庫:
mkdir wap cd wap git init touch README.md git add README.md git commit -m "first commit" git remote add origin https://git.oschina.net/name/package.git git push -u origin master
已有項(xiàng)目?
cd existing_git_repo git remote add origin https://git.oschina.net/name/package.git git push -u origin master
下面說下詳細(xì)的本地操作步驟:
1、用vs打開你的項(xiàng)目文件夾
2、配置git
打開Git Bash輸入以下命令
如果還沒輸入全局配置就先把這個(gè)全局配置輸入上去
Git 全局設(shè)置:
git config --global user.name "ASxx" git config --global user.email 123456789@qq.com
然后開始做提交代碼到碼云的配置
cd d:/wamp/www/mall360/wap //首先指定到你的項(xiàng)目目錄下 git init touch README.md git add README.md git commit -m "first commit" git remote add origin https://git.oschina.net/name/package.git //用你倉庫的url git push -u origin master //提交到你的倉庫
正常情況下上面的命令執(zhí)行完成后,本地文件夾會有一個(gè)隱藏的.git文件夾,云端你的倉庫里應(yīng)該會有一個(gè)README.md文件。
3、在vscode中提交代碼到倉庫
回到vs code打開git工作區(qū)就會看到所有代碼顯示在這里
點(diǎn)擊+號,把所有文件提交到暫存區(qū)。
然后打開菜單選擇--提交已暫存的
然后按提示隨便在消息框里輸入一個(gè)消息,再按ctrl+enter提交
然后把所有暫存的代碼push云端,
點(diǎn)擊后,會彈出讓你輸入賬號密碼,把你托管平臺的賬號密碼輸入上去就行了。。。
不出問題的話你整個(gè)項(xiàng)目就會提交到云端上了。
在vs中每次更新代碼都會要輸入賬號密碼,方便起見,可以配置一下讓GIT記住密碼賬號。
git config --global credential.helper store //在Git Bash輸入這個(gè)命令就可以了
4、同步代碼
這里說下平時(shí)修改代碼后提交到云端的使用,和本地代碼和云端同步
隨便打開一個(gè)文件,添加一個(gè)注釋
可以看到git圖標(biāo)有一個(gè)提示,打開git工作區(qū)可以看到就是修改的這個(gè)文件
然后點(diǎn)擊右側(cè)的+號,把他暫存起來。
再在消息框里輸入消息,按ctrl+enter提交暫存
再點(diǎn)擊push提交,代碼就提交到云端了。
打開 碼云就可以看到了。。
pull使用
比如當(dāng)你在家里修改了代碼提交到云端后,回到公司只需要用vscode打開項(xiàng)目點(diǎn)擊菜單中的pull就可以同步過來了。
5、克隆你的項(xiàng)目到本地
回到家后想修改代碼,但是電腦沒有文件怎么辦呢? 往下看
首先你電腦還是的有vscode 和 GIT,,然后用git把上面那些全局配置再執(zhí)行一次,如下
git config --global user.name "ASxx" git config --global user.email "123456789@qq.com" git config --global credential.helper store
然后打開Git Bash輸入以下命令
cd d:/test //指定存放的目錄 git clone https://git.oschina.net/name/test.git //你的倉庫地址
下載成功,然后就可以用vscode打開項(xiàng)目修改了,修改后提交的步驟還是和上面一樣:暫存-提交暫存-push提交到云端就ok了。
以上就是本文的全部內(nèi)容,希望對大家的學(xué)習(xí)有所幫助,也希望大家多多支持腳本之家。
相關(guān)文章
在VPS上用3Proxy架設(shè)http代理和socks代理(Ubuntu環(huán)境)
前幾天記錄了在廉價(jià)的xen vps主機(jī)上通過squid架設(shè)http代理的情況,試用效果非常不錯(cuò)。但是現(xiàn)在需要增加socks代理,這方便squid就無能為力了,于是改用傳說中的輕量級的NB代理軟件3Proxy。2010-07-07Win2003 Server DHCP服務(wù)器安裝圖解教程
為了節(jié)省IP地址資源,IP地址采用了DHCP自動分配方式2012-10-10搭建dnsmasq自運(yùn)營dns服務(wù)器的實(shí)現(xiàn)步驟
DNSmasq是一個(gè)輕巧的,容易使用的DNS服務(wù)工具,本文主要介紹了搭建dnsmasq自運(yùn)營dns服務(wù)器的實(shí)現(xiàn)步驟,具有一定的參考價(jià)值,感興趣的可以了解一下2024-01-01DELL R710服務(wù)器做RAID5磁盤陣列圖文教程
這篇文章主要介紹了DELL R710服務(wù)器做RAID5磁盤陣列圖文教程,需要的朋友可以參考下2014-08-08svn服務(wù)器安裝在centos7系統(tǒng)平臺
本文給大家介紹的是在centos7系統(tǒng)上安裝svn服務(wù)器的詳細(xì)教程,有需要的小伙伴可以參考下2018-04-04虛擬主機(jī)應(yīng)該如何解決電信網(wǎng)通間互聯(lián)互通
電信和網(wǎng)通兩大基礎(chǔ)網(wǎng)絡(luò),人為地割裂了整個(gè)中國的網(wǎng)絡(luò)。無論是選擇把網(wǎng)站托管在電信、還是網(wǎng)通,都等于是在拒絕處于另外一個(gè)網(wǎng)絡(luò)中的客戶,因?yàn)閷?shí)在太慢了2011-10-10Rsync ERROR: auth failed on module解決方法
今天在兩臺服務(wù)器同步備份在用戶權(quán)限上糾結(jié)了很多,主要關(guān)于這個(gè)問題網(wǎng)上的配置方法不一,源自rsync版本不一致,這里簡單總結(jié)下,方便需要的朋友2013-09-09